Description
Ustiloxin E CAS NO 158253-87-3 is a potent cyclic peptide mycotoxin produced by the fungus *Ustilaginoidea virens*. This compound is of significant interest in biochemical and pharmacological research due to its specific bioactivity and role as a phytotoxin. It serves as a critical reference standard and research material for scientists in agrochemical development, plant pathology, and natural product chemistry.
Application
- Phytotoxin Research: Used as a reference standard to study its mechanism of action on rice plants and other crops.
- Biochemical Pathway Analysis: Employed in research to investigate fungal virulence and host-pathogen interactions.
- Agrochemical Development: Serves as a lead compound or a tool for screening and developing novel plant protection agents.
- Natural Product Isolation & Synthesis: Acts as a benchmark in the isolation, purification, and total synthesis studies of complex fungal metabolites.
- Toxicology Studies: Utilized in safety and toxicological assessments relevant to food security and agricultural safety.
- Academic & Institutional Research: Essential for universities and research institutes focusing on mycology and plant science.
